AGC problem
Good evening friends, I just installed Zgemma in image 6.2 and I see in the channel signals the SNR at 90% and the AGG at 5% on almost all channels, but they do not pixelate, they look perfectly, I put a meter field and it gives me SNR 90% and AGG 78%.The problem I see is the image that marks the hairline much less than what the meter really marksThank you

AGC is a meaningless values, only cosmetic for Enigma2. It does not affect reception and should never be taken seriously by the users.
SNR is the only useful value and that when it's not a percentage but a db indication (you can change that in the settings). Percentages also mean nothing and cannot be comparable, SNR is a signal to noise ratio value and as every value in physics it is measured in units. dB is that unit.
